Sustainability Trends in Structural Sealant Materials
In recent years, the focus on sustainability in structural sealant materials has intensified. Manufacturers are increasingly adopting eco-friendly practices. This trend reflects a larger push towards reducing environmental impact. Many companies are now utilizing bio-based materials, which significantly reduce carbon footprints.
Recycling in the sealant industry is gaining traction. Using recycled materials not only conserves resources but also minimizes waste. Innovations in production processes enhance material longevity. This not only benefits the environment but also meets durability demands in construction projects.
**Tip:** Look for structural sealants with third-party certifications. These guarantee sustainability claims and ensure reliability.
Another evolving trend is the development of low-VOC sealants. These offer safer indoor air quality, which is crucial in residential and commercial buildings. Despite these advancements, challenges remain. Not all eco-friendly products perform equally under various conditions. Researching performance data is essential for informed choices.

Innovative Applications of Structural Sealants in Construction
Structural sealants play a crucial role in modern construction. They provide flexibility and durability, essential for both commercial and residential buildings. Recently, their applications have expanded beyond traditional uses. They are now vital in addressing energy efficiency and sustainability in architecture.
Innovative uses of structural sealants have emerged. For example, many architects are using these materials for glazing applications. This creates a seamless look while improving thermal performance. These sealants can also bond dissimilar materials, allowing for more creative designs. In some cases, older buildings are retrofitted with new sealants, enhancing their longevity.
However, challenges persist. Not all sealants perform equally under extreme weather conditions. The demand for eco-friendly options continues to rise. Some sealants now incorporate recycled materials, contributing to green building initiatives. Yet, sourcing reliable products can be tricky.
